Pandemic Influenza Planning Project for Tribes

Through a contractual agreement with the Oklahoma State Department of Health (OSDH), the SPIEC/Oklahoma City Area Inter-Tribal Health Board is providing technical assistance to the 39 Oklahoma tribes for Pandemic Influenza Planning/All Hazards Plan. Each Tribe that submits a completed plan to the Health Board which is approved by the OSDH will be eligible to receive financial assistance that may allow them to continue preparedness activities.

To receive funds for the Pandemic Influenza plan:

  • Tribal pandemic influenza plans approved by OSDH;
  • Participate on the Oklahoma Inter-Tribal Emergency Management Coalition (ITEMC); and
  • Show evidence of a relationship with their surrounding county health and emergency management partners.
  • Attend a OCAITHB National Incident Management System Compliant Preparedness training to ensure each tribal participant meets the OSDH requirement of receiving NIMS training
  • Receive certification of the following:

            ICS-100: Introduction to Incident Command System (ICS)
            ICS-200: ICS for Single Resources and Initial Action Incidents

            ICS-700: Introduction to National Incident Management System

            ICS-800: Introduction to National Response Framework
